Optimization of Emergency Response Routes in Educational Institutions: A Study on the Health Department Building at Politeknik Negeri Jember
Abstract
Introduction: The safety of occupants in high-rise buildings is a primary concern, especially in Indonesia, which is prone to fires and earthquakes. The Health Department Building at Politeknik Negeri Jember faces challenges in meeting safety standards, such as insufficient directional signs, inadequate emergency lighting, and suboptimal assembly points. Research Objectives: To evaluate and optimize the emergency response routes in the Health Department Building of Politeknik Negeri Jember. Methods: The study utilized an observational method by directly examining the conditions of the emergency response routes in the Health Department Building. The data collected were analyzed and used to redesign the evacuation routes using SketchUp software. Results: The findings revealed that the evacuation routes did not meet safety standards, with deficiencies including inconspicuous directional signs, substandard emergency lighting, and poorly located assembly points. Recommendations included improving facilities, adjusting layouts, and adding safety signs to enhance evacuation efficiency and occupant safety. Conclusion: Optimizing evacuation routes is expected to improve the safety of building occupants. This study provides recommendations for better emergency response management, which are also applicable to other educational institutions.
